The appeal is determined under Section 54 TMA 1970 where you and the employer agree that either
the default count or
the amount on which the surcharge is based is incorrect.
Where the default count is incorrect
amend the default count using BROCS function AME
unset the surcharge appeal signal using BROCS VIEW TAXPAYER ASA SS (format 1).
Where the amount on which the surcharge is based is incorrect
refer to DMBM521830.
In both cases
issue the letter PAYE214 suitably amended
make a suitable note on IDMS Action History
make a note in the Notes/Actions column of the MIS spreadsheet
continue pursuit of the amended surcharge if appropriate.
